The Celtics (6-1) return home to face the Raptors (4-2) tonight. Boston rides a 3-game win streak into the game, including their big win yesterday in Detroit. Toronto was predicting by folks to be a strong contender in the East this year. They return Chris Bosh (26.7 points, 11.0 rebounds) one of the best big men in basketball, as well as sure handed point guard Jose Calderon (16.2 points, 9.3 assists). They have also added former All Star Jermaine O’Neal (10.5 points, 6.3 rebounds) who may not be the dominant inside force he was with Indiana, but certainly adds another presence in the paint to couple with Bosh. Boston will certainly have their hands full tonight, especially coming off a big road game yesterday. Follow all of the action right here!
